Collaborative Leadership in Action: Partnering for Success in Schools
Wepner, Shelley B.; Hopkins, Dee
Teachers College Press
"Collaborative Leadership in Action" is about creating school-university-community partnerships and the leaders who build and sustain them. It defines and describes different types of collaborative partnerships and discusses how to develop, maintain, and evaluate relationships that enrich the PreK-16 learning environment. Speaking from the leadership perspectives of both PreK-12 and higher education, real-life examples illustrate theories and practices of successful collaborative leaders partnering across organizations. The final chapter provides a set of considerations and guidelines for effective collaborative leadership. This book features: (1) Strategies for developing partnerships that have the potential to be transformational; (2) Vignettes of different types of partnerships; (3) Multiple perspectives from PreK-12 and higher education participants; and (4) Lessons collaborative leaders can use to keep partnerships afloat.
